Description Suggest change

Once cleaned up, this is probably a nice TR problem.  The FA team noted it was "a good free solo".

Find the crack, climb the face and crack using whatever methods of levitation you have. It tops out on a flat ledge and there are some TR options possible here.

Walk off left and back down to the Stairmaster.

Location Suggest change

Find the upper entrance to the OHG area by topping out the steps of the Stairmaster and walking up to the flat area.  Look to your right and find a faint trail (cairn might be there) leading to a steep wall with an obvious shallow crack.  This is the line.  You might be able to get some micro-protection in there now that wasn't available in 1983...but not much.

Protection Suggest change

If anything, micronuts (brass) and very small cams.
